A clinical case of combined radiation treatment of a patient with oral floor mucosa cancer St III T3N1M0 was presented. Pathogistological diagnosis # xxxxxx was: highly differentiated squamous cell carcinoma. A treatment plan was developed. Chemoradiotherapy at the first stage included 3 courses of intra-arterial chemotherapy (Selective (superselective) embolization (chemoembolization) of tumor vessels in the basin of the left and right facial and left lingual arteries, cisplatin 150 mg, combined with a daily infusion of 5-fluorouracil 4000 mg), with an interval 21 day. Chemoradiotherapy at the second stage included volume modulated arc therapy (VMAT) on the area of ​​the primary tumor (oral floor mucosa) and the regional metastasis pathways (total boost dose 60 Gy to the area of ​​regional lymph flow, otal boost dose 50 Gy to the oral cavity). Chemoradiotherapy at stage 3 included interstitial radiation therapy. A single boost dose (SBD) for the primary focus was 3 Gy/per fraction, 2 times a day, with an interval of 6 hours until total boost dose reached 21 Gy, 7 fractions.Results. After treatment, a complete regression of the tumor was noted. No pathological accumulation of radiopharmaceuticals, features of the tumor process was detected on PET/CT 48 months after treatment.Conclusions. Chemoradiotherapy combined with brachytherapy can be considered as an equal alternative to surgical treatment of patients with oral mucosa cancer.</p></abstract><trans-abstract xml:lang="ru"><p><bold>Цель:</bold> улучшить результаты лечения рака слизистой дна полости рта при невозможности проведения хирургического лечения.</p> <p><bold>Материалы и методы</bold>: представлен клинический случай сочетанного лучевого лечения пациента с раком слизистой дна полости рта St III T3N1M0.
